Product DescriptionThe Motorola Krave may resemble a “Star-Trek” communicator when the flip touchscreen is opened, but what makes this phone unique is the two-layer touch interface achieved with a transparent capacitive mesh screen. With the flip closed, the user can choose, with the touch of a finger, from a four-icon menu located across the top of the display for TV, photos, navigation, and incoming messages. With the flip open, twelve additional menu icons become available.
Although the earpiece speaker appears to be suspended within the transparent flip, a mesh of photo-patterned capacitive metal lines embedded in the clear plastic enables the four-icon menu. The mesh also supplies power to the speaker.
The Krave, available through Verizon in the U.S. market, supports a host of premium features, including V-cast mobile TV, music (via the “Rhapsody” service), visual voicemail, mobile e-mail, an HTML browser, voice commands, iTAP predictive text entry, IM, and SMS, MMS, and EMS messaging. Internal memory can be supplemented with a microSD card, providing up to 8Gb of storage for photos taken with the 2.0MP camera.
Motorola claims 500 hours of standby operation and 250 minutes of talk-time for the Krave.
Product Teardown Report DescriptionLevel 2 Chipography Reports identify primary ICs, provide die-size parameters, and include selected die photos and information on major sub-assemblies such as camera and display module, but also include price estimates for the ICs and total overall component counts. Product Teardown Report Content
Chipography® Report Contents:
* Product Details * Major IC Bill of Materials * Major Components * Main Board photos * Main Board IC Identification * Selected Die Photos * Selected Display Modules and Board Photos
